Output 51d0c08fcfcaa17109a7b2688342562ab58ac61d9b02718b90998d8b7e8258a3:6

value
1049886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9eac3294914531522ddf92c9bf51ea01def6885 OP_EQUALVERIFY OP_CHECKSIG
address
1KQe48ebJGCc6cdKptNdDovSGRYgv5wWiH
transaction
51d0c08fcfcaa17109a7b2688342562ab58ac61d9b02718b90998d8b7e8258a3
spent
true